As a Respiratory Therapist in Saint Albans, you will play a vital role in providing care and support to patients with respiratory conditions. Your responsibilities will include assessing patients, developing treatment plans, and administering therapies to improve their respiratory health. This specialty offers immense room for professional growth and development. In addition to the rewarding nature of the work itself, you will enjoy competitive benefits that make this opportunity even more enticing. With a weekly pay range of $1,338 to $1,442, you will be fairly compensated for your expertise and dedication. While the guaranteed hours are not specified, the final compensation package and guaranteed hours will be confirmed during the hiring process.
